W: It's easy for parents to get worried about their kids being left behind. And as is known to all, two-year-olds don't need a computer. But early childhood experts agree that two-year-olds need the experience of using a computer. At the age of 3.5, most children can learn to handle the mouse. At this age, kids may not need a  computer, but they'll enjoy it. And they'll learn from it, often in unforeseen ways. Judy Salpeter, San Francisco, California, the editor of Tech & Learning, remembers that when her son was three years old, he loved a PaintBox program that allowed him to position stamps of little figures on the screen. One day, she overheard him saying, "I'll put all these here because they're food, and all these here because they're animals."  Although the software hadn't been designed to teach classification, it allowed him to experiment with that idea himself. If you don't have a computer by the time your child goes to school, he'll form his first impression of computers in the classroom. It's OK for children to learn the computer at school. But if they have used it at home, they'll feel smarter and it's easier for them to succeed in their studies. By third or fourth grade, however, students may be at a definite disadvantage in both writing and research if they don't have at-home access to word processing programs.

What is it like to travel in space? If you have ever watched space movies, you may know something about it. Aurora Station is the world's first space hotel. The US company Orion Span built the hotel. The hotel is around 12 feet wide and 35 feet long.   It plans to welcome its first guests in 2022. It will fly 320 kilometers above Earth.   It can hold six people at a time. Two of them will be workers. They may be former NASA astronauts. Each trip aboard the station will last for 12 days. Guests there will be able to do many interesting things. For example, they will see around 16 sunrises and sunsets every 24 hours. They can take part in research experiments such as growing food in space. Later, they can bring the food back to Earth as a souvenir. These are the same things as astronauts usually do. Guests can also share what they see and hear with others on Earth. They can have a video chat using a high-speed Internet connection. But each guest will have to pay at least $9.5 million. That's really a large amount of money.

M: We're glad to have Dr. Garfield to talk to us today about dreams. Let me start by asking the first question. Does everyone dream?

W: It appears that everyone does. Mostly, when people say that they never dream, what they really mean is that they don't remember their dreams or that they don't think their dreams are important. The reason behind is that they might have been made fun of as a child when they first reported their dreams or that it was so frightening that they just turned off dreaming completely. The other day someone named Davis came to me and said that he used to be a great dreamer. But suddenly, he stopped having dreams. I asked him what had happened. It turned out that his brother died of a heart attack. And he never expected that such a terrible thing would happen to a young person. Generally, when there were some frightening events and to dream about them was too terrible, people prefer not to dream about them. Actually, the worst thing you can do is stop dreaming, because it means that the bad experience was too painful to even appear in dreams. As long as you're dreaming about it and even if the dream is frightening, your mind is working on it.  My personal opinion about what dreams do is that they help us deal with our problems. We see certain patterns take place in dreams when a person is hurt deep inside, when a person is seriously ill or when a person has been really sad. If people turn off their dreams totally, it means they don't allow themselves to even think about it.

W: You don't need millions to be happy. In fact, a couple of hundred dollars may be enough at the Happiness Research Institute in Australia. The institute opened its doors last year, and, since then, men and women of all ages have been paying for lessons on how to feel great. Experts say that only 15 percent of happiness comes from income and other financial factors. As much as 85 percent comes from things such as attitudes, life control and relationships. Most of us are significantly wealthier financially than our parents, but happiness levels haven't changed to reflect that. Studies show that once the basic needs of shelter and food are met, additional wealth adds very little to happiness. Part of the reason why we are richer but not happier is that we compare ourselves to people better off materially. So if you want to be happy, there's a very simple thing you can do: Compare yourself to people who are less wealthy than you — poorer, with a smaller house and car. The Happiness Research Institute aims to show you how to overcome these unhappy factors by focusing on "more than just your bank account".
